What Is Cortisol Belly?
Cortisol belly refers to the accumulation of abdominal fat driven by chronically elevated cortisol levels. While it is not a formal medical diagnosis, the term describes a well-documented pattern: persistent stress leads to excess cortisol, which promotes fat storage specifically around the midsection.
Cortisol is a steroid hormone produced by your adrenal glands. It plays essential roles in regulating metabolism, blood sugar, inflammation, and your sleep-wake cycle. In short bursts, cortisol helps you respond to threats by flooding your bloodstream with glucose for quick energy. The problem starts when that stress response never fully shuts off.
Chronic stress from work pressure, sleep deprivation, financial strain, or relationship conflict keeps your hypothalamic-pituitary-adrenal (HPA) axis activated. Over time, the negative feedback mechanism that normally reins in cortisol becomes blunted, and your body sits in a state of sustained hormonal elevation that changes how it handles energy and fat.
How Does Cortisol Cause Belly Fat?
The science behind cortisol-driven belly fat is more specific than most people realize. Cortisol does not simply cause weight gain everywhere. It preferentially directs fat storage to the visceral cavity, the space deep in your abdomen surrounding your liver, pancreas, and intestines.
Here is how this process works:
- More cortisol receptors in visceral fat: Abdominal fat cells contain a higher density of glucocorticoid receptors compared to fat cells in your arms, legs, or hips. This makes your midsection especially responsive to cortisol signaling.
- Enzyme activation (11-beta HSD1): An enzyme called 11-beta-hydroxysteroid dehydrogenase type 1 converts inactive cortisone into active cortisol directly inside fat cells, amplifying the fat-storage signal at the local level.
- Insulin resistance: Chronic cortisol elevation raises blood sugar levels and promotes insulin resistance. Higher insulin signals your body to store more fat, especially around the abdomen.
- Increased appetite and cravings: Cortisol stimulates appetite, particularly for high-calorie, sugary, and fatty foods. This creates a caloric surplus that tends to be deposited as visceral fat.
- Muscle breakdown: Cortisol is catabolic, meaning it breaks down lean muscle tissue. Less muscle mass means a lower basal metabolic rate, making fat loss even harder.
Research published in Obesity Reviews confirms that people with chronically elevated cortisol show significantly greater visceral fat accumulation, even when total body weight remains relatively stable. The result is a self-reinforcing loop: stress drives cortisol, cortisol drives belly fat, and visceral fat itself produces inflammatory signals that keep cortisol elevated.
Signs You May Have Cortisol Belly
Cortisol belly does not always look like dramatic weight gain. It often develops gradually and shows up alongside other symptoms of high cortisol that are easy to dismiss. Watch for these patterns:
- Visceral fat distribution: You carry weight primarily around your midsection while your arms and legs stay relatively lean. Your belly may feel firm and round rather than soft.
- Apple-shaped body: Your waist measurement is disproportionately larger compared to your hips, a classic sign of cortisol-influenced fat distribution.
- Fatigue paired with belly weight gain: You feel constantly exhausted despite adequate sleep, and weight around your middle seems to increase during high-stress periods.
- Stress eating and sugar cravings: You find yourself reaching for comfort foods, especially carbohydrates and sweets, when under pressure.
- Poor sleep combined with weight gain: Disrupted sleep raises nighttime cortisol, creating a cycle where poor rest fuels fat storage and belly fat disrupts sleep quality further.
- Exercise resistance: Your midsection does not respond to traditional diet and exercise approaches the way the rest of your body does.
If several of these signs resonate, elevated cortisol may be contributing to your abdominal fat

How Do You Test Your Cortisol Levels?
If you suspect cortisol is behind your belly fat, testing provides the data you need to take targeted action. Not all cortisol tests are created equal, and the right choice depends on what you want to learn.
Blood cortisol test
A standard blood draw measures total cortisol at a single point in time. It is useful for detecting extreme cortisol conditions like Cushing’s syndrome or Addison’s disease, but it misses the nuance of how your cortisol fluctuates throughout the day.
Salivary cortisol test
Salivary tests collect multiple samples throughout the day to map your cortisol rhythm. This provides insight into whether your cortisol follows a healthy pattern (high in the morning, low at night) or has become dysregulated.
DUTCH test (Dried Urine Test for Comprehensive Hormones)
The DUTCH test is the gold standard for comprehensive cortisol assessment. It measures cortisol metabolites, free cortisol, cortisone, and the full cortisol curve over a 24-hour period. This reveals not just how much cortisol your body produces but how efficiently it processes and clears it.

Evidence-Based Ways to Reduce Cortisol Belly
Getting rid of cortisol belly requires a different strategy than standard weight loss. You need to address the root cause: chronic stress and the hormonal cascade it triggers.
Stress management
- Sleep optimization: Aim for 7 to 9 hours of quality sleep. Poor sleep is one of the most powerful cortisol elevators. Establish a consistent sleep schedule and minimize screen exposure before bed.
- Meditation and breathwork: Research shows that regular mindfulness meditation can reduce salivary cortisol by up to 25%. Even 10 to 15 minutes of deep breathing activates your parasympathetic nervous system and lowers cortisol.
- HRV training: Heart rate variability biofeedback teaches your nervous system to shift from fight-or-flight into recovery mode, improving your stress resilience over time.
- Adaptogens: Ashwagandha has the strongest clinical evidence among adaptogens for cortisol reduction. A 2019 study found that 600mg daily reduced cortisol levels significantly compared to placebo.
Exercise (the right kind)
- Walking: Low-intensity movement like daily 30 to 45 minute walks is one of the most effective cortisol-lowering exercises. It reduces stress without triggering additional cortisol release.
- Strength training: Resistance training builds lean muscle mass, which increases your metabolic rate and improves insulin sensitivity. Keep sessions to 45 to 60 minutes to avoid overtraining.
- Avoid overtraining: Excessive high-intensity exercise raises cortisol further. If you are chronically stressed, marathon cardio sessions and extreme HIIT may be making your cortisol belly worse, not better.

Nutrition strategies

- Anti-inflammatory diet: Focus on whole foods rich in omega-3 fatty acids, leafy greens, berries, and quality proteins. Chronic inflammation elevates cortisol, so reducing inflammatory inputs helps lower it.
- Blood sugar stabilization: Eat balanced meals with protein, healthy fats, and fiber every 3 to 4 hours. Blood sugar crashes trigger cortisol spikes as your body scrambles to restore glucose levels.
- Caffeine reduction: Caffeine directly stimulates cortisol production. If you are dealing with cortisol belly, consider limiting coffee to one cup in the morning and avoiding caffeine after noon.
- Magnesium-rich foods: Magnesium supports HPA axis regulation. Dark chocolate, spinach, pumpkin seeds, and almonds are excellent sources.
Hormone optimization
Cortisol does not operate in isolation. It directly interacts with testosterone, estrogen, progesterone, and thyroid hormones. When cortisol stays elevated, it can suppress testosterone production in men and disrupt the estrogen-progesterone balance in women, compounding belly fat accumulation.
For women navigating perimenopause or menopause, declining estrogen and progesterone levels make cortisol’s impact even more pronounced. Menopause-related belly fat often has a cortisol component that standard approaches miss. Bioidentical hormone replacement therapy (BHRT) may help restore hormonal balance when lifestyle changes alone are not enough.
When Diet and Exercise Are Not Enough
Sometimes, cortisol belly persists despite genuine effort with nutrition, exercise, and stress management. When that happens, it usually signals an underlying hormonal imbalance that needs clinical attention.
Common culprits include:
- Thyroid dysfunction: Hypothyroidism slows metabolism and compounds cortisol-related weight gain. Even subclinical thyroid issues can make belly fat stubbornly resistant to change.
- Adrenal dysfunction: Prolonged stress can lead to HPA axis dysregulation where cortisol patterns become erratic, with levels too high at night and too low in the morning.
- Perimenopause cortisol spikes: Women in perimenopause often experience dramatic cortisol fluctuations as progesterone (which has a calming effect on the HPA axis) declines. This creates a hormonal environment that strongly favors visceral fat storage.
- Insulin resistance: Chronic cortisol elevation and insulin resistance feed each other in a destructive cycle. Without addressing both, belly fat reduction becomes significantly harder.
If lifestyle changes have not moved the needle, comprehensive lab testing can identify which hormonal pathways need support.

Frequently Asked Questions About Cortisol Belly
Is cortisol belly a real medical condition?
Cortisol belly is not a formal medical diagnosis, but the underlying mechanism is well-supported by research. Chronic cortisol elevation promotes visceral fat storage through increased glucocorticoid receptor activity, insulin resistance, and appetite dysregulation. The pattern is real even if the name is informal.
How long does it take to lose cortisol belly?
Most people begin to see changes in waist circumference within 4 to 8 weeks of consistently managing stress, improving sleep, and optimizing nutrition. However, if underlying hormonal imbalances are involved, comprehensive testing and targeted protocols typically accelerate results.
Can you lose cortisol belly fat without lowering cortisol?
It is very difficult. Even with a calorie deficit, elevated cortisol promotes visceral fat retention while breaking down lean muscle. Addressing cortisol through sleep, stress management, and recovery is essential for meaningful belly fat loss.
Does exercise make cortisol belly worse?
It depends on the type and intensity. Excessive high-intensity exercise and overtraining can raise cortisol further. Moderate activities like walking, strength training, and yoga are more effective for reducing cortisol-related belly fat than extreme cardio sessions.
What is the difference between cortisol belly and Cushing’s syndrome?
Cushing’s syndrome is a rare medical condition caused by severe, sustained cortisol excess, often from a tumor. It produces dramatic symptoms including moon face, purple stretch marks, and rapid central weight gain. Cortisol belly from chronic stress involves lower-grade cortisol elevation and responds to lifestyle and hormonal interventions.
What blood tests show if cortisol is causing belly fat?
A comprehensive panel should include serum cortisol, salivary cortisol rhythm (or DUTCH test), fasting insulin, HOMA-IR (insulin resistance score), hemoglobin A1c, thyroid markers, and sex hormones. This combination reveals whether cortisol and its downstream effects are driving your abdominal fat storage.
Does cortisol belly affect men and women differently?
Yes. Women are more susceptible during perimenopause and menopause when declining progesterone removes a natural buffer against cortisol’s effects. Men with chronically elevated cortisol often experience simultaneous testosterone suppression, which compounds belly fat accumulation and muscle loss.
Can cortisol belly cause other health problems?
Visceral fat associated with cortisol belly is metabolically active and produces inflammatory compounds linked to increased risk of type 2 diabetes, cardiovascular disease, metabolic syndrome, and fatty liver disease. Addressing cortisol belly is not just about appearance; it is about long-term health.
